Location
This photo was taken in the Columbia River Gorge in Oregon. You're looking at the last bit of the trail that ends at the overlook for bridal veil falls.Time
This was shot between 5 and 6pm in late October. So the light wasn't too harsh, and probably a little dim under the canopy.Lighting
It was mostly flat lighting beneath the canopy, with the sky being the brightest part of the scene. Thats why I chose to find a composition without much sky, since I'd be losing the details there in this single exposure image.Equipment
This was shot on my old Nikon D60 with an 18-55mm lens. Looking at the metadata, I can see I didn't quite know what I was doing at the time (nearly 10 years ago) because I set up on a tripod and got a 25 second exposure at f/22 with ISO 100. I definitely wouldn't use those settings today.Inspiration
I was inspired to photograph this area because I grew up in the bay area and I was absolutely enamored with the woods and waterfalls.Editing
I used Lightroom and Photoshop to do some basic edits to the image.In my camera bag
I always have a 35mm and an 11-16mm in my bag, along with filters, batteries, and lens wipes. I also keep a small first aid kit and a headlamp with me.Feedback
Just get out there and start shooting. Composition is key. Move around and try different angles until you find one that you like.
